UPPER BLEPHAROPLASTY (Eyelid Lift)

eyelid lift modelWith aging, extra undesirable skin accumulates in the upper eyelid. Increased fatty tissue producing a heavier looking upper lid also becomes more noticeable with age. The extra skin and fat hide the normal upper lid crease that is associated with the youthful upper eyelid. During eyelid surgery, this excessive skin, fat, and muscle is removed. This procedure can be accomplished with limited anesthesia, local or with a variety of sedation techniques.

The result is a smoother upper eyelid with a well-defined crease. The position of this surgical scar in this crease makes it almost invisible with time.

Recovery is relatively rapid. Discomfort is minimal and analgesics are usually not needed after the first few days.
